Phase II Proposed technologies

11

  1. Onion solar curing technology will be developed, verified, and demonstrated at the irrigation site

22

2. Sustainable tomato paste prevention technology will be developed and demonstrated at the Fogera irrigation site

33

3. Solar drying technology for potato powder and mango slice production at the Koga irrigation site

  • 44

    4. Rain shelter technology will be constructed for volunteer farmers to grow tomatoes during the rainy season at the Koga irrigation site
